Stress During Pregnancy: Its Signs, Effects, And Tips To Reduce It

Stress during Pregnancy is common, But sometimes too much stress can make you uncomfortable.

Stress during Pregnancy makes it difficult to sleep, headache, loss of appetite, restlessness & much more. You need a Positive outlook to deal with Stress During Pregnancy

Causes of Stress During Pregnancy:

The causes of vary with different types of woman. Here we are discussing some of the common causes of stress during pregnancy:

Woman find it difficult with the change & discomforts of pregnancy like nausea, vomiting, indigestion etc.

Change in Hormones brings mood swings which indirectly invites Stress. Worrying about the time of labor & responsibilities of a newborn.

The working woman worried about what to choose or how to balance child upbringing & work.

How does Stress cause Pregnancy problems?

It’s difficult to rule out the effects of stress on pregnancy. But stress has some impact on hormonal secretion. As some stress-related hormones have a negative impact on pregnancy.

Hormonal imbalance weakens the immune system. Hence the body is easily prone to infections. This type of infection can cause premature birth.

Intake of an excess amount of alcohol consumption, smoking, drugs can also lead to stress during pregnancy

How to reduce Stress during Pregnancy?

Some positive steps you can take:

Rest & relax – take time for yourself and Relax . its good for you and your baby growth. Listen to music or have a spa or read your favorite book or spend quality time with your better half.

Discuss Pregnancy -If you have worries about your pregnancy have a chit chat with your partner, clear your doubts with the doctor & your mother. Talking things through can make you feel better.

Eat & Sleep well – Keep an eagle eye on your diet during pregnancy. Well, a balanced diet is good for you & your baby.

Eat light food easily digestible, increase intake of liquid diet like Juices, water. Sound sleep not only refreshes your mind but also boost up your feelings of well-being.

Switch to Exercise – Exercise keeps you healthy & fit. It can be done in any form – a warm-up exercise, morning walk, light sessions of Yoga or meditation, Swimming. Exercises are good enough to control your anxieties and make you feel light.

Go for Complementary Therapies – Checkout for the Meditation sessions, Yoga sessions, Laughter sessions in your area. These therapies are a fantastic way to de-stress.
